Transaction 5ee33d781b4fc4396ea46ae003fc24ba2ba5b46a7fb4ea72f2e2676dbdf01c8e
2 Input
2 Outputs
- 5ee33d781b4fc4396ea46ae003fc24ba2ba5b46a7fb4ea72f2e2676dbdf01c8e:0
- 5ee33d781b4fc4396ea46ae003fc24ba2ba5b46a7fb4ea72f2e2676dbdf01c8e:1
value 2057710
address 14EfwZFNczgKoVKJBHG4KcPFCR1F1iBMUt
value 16300000
address 39jdbZ9atiVs7gAVR35MZm4BfZRnunJ2PP